1. The Unofficial Ghibli Cookbook – by Thibaud Vilanova

The Unofficial Ghibli Cookbook
With 40 delectable dishes from beloved Studio Ghibli films like Spirited Away, crafted by culinary specialist Thibaud Villanova.

With ’40 delicious dishes’ inspired by iconic films like My Neighbor Totoro, Spirited Away, and Howl’s Moving Castle. Crafted by renowned chef and pop-culture expert Thibaud Villanova, these recipes delve into the imaginative worlds of Ghibli, offering a taste of the fantastical.

With over 16 cookbooks to his name and a passion for blending food with popular culture, Villanova brings his expertise to this collection. From ramen to bento boxes, each dish reflects the magic and charm of Studio Ghibli’s masterpieces, inviting fans to savor their favorite scenes in a whole new way.

2. The Unofficial Studio Ghibli Cookbook – by Jessica Yun

The Unofficial Studio Ghibli Cookbook: 50+ Delicious Recipes…
With 50 unofficial, fan-created recipes inspired by Miyazaki’s iconic films. Recreate the mouthwatering dishes from beloved scenes.

Featuring 50 fan-created Japanese recipes inspired by Studio Ghibli’s magical tales, this collection invites you to recreate the mouthwatering dishes showcased since 1985.

From breakfast delights to Japanese classics like yakitori and onigiri, indulge in skillet bacon and eggs, ramen with “haaaam,” herring and pumpkin pot pie, steamed red bean bao, and salmon with beurre blanc sauce.

Perfect for fans of Japanese anime, manga, and comfort cooking, this cookbook is a delightful homage to Miyazaki’s iconic storytelling, crafted by passionate food blogger and data health analyst Jessica Ann Yun.

3. Studio Ghibli Cookbook – by Minh-Tri Vo

Studio Ghibli Cookbook: Unofficial Recipes Inspired by…
Featuring 20+ recipes inspired by beloved films like Totoro and Spirited Away. Perfect for all skill levels and Ghibli fans.

With over twenty recipes inspired by iconic scenes, from My Neighbor Totoro’s comforting bento to Spirited Away’s tantalizing red bean buns, this cookbook captures the essence of Ghibli’s magical worlds. Stunning, full-color images accompany each recipe, guiding chefs of all levels through the process.

Whether you’re a beginner or experienced cook, the easy-to-follow instructions and common ingredients ensure a seamless cooking experience. Perfect for Studio Ghibli fans, this cookbook is a heartfelt tribute to the renowned animation studio’s greatest masterpieces.
